What’s happening:
City Council posted an agenda for November 4, 2020, to discuss banning canopies on the beach.
 
Why it matters:

  • Most residents and property owners own canopies rather than single pole umbrellas.
  • It’s winter season when beach use is at a minimum.
  • There are suspicions that this order could be designed to favor vendors over residents. 

Whats next:
If this issue is important to you, attend the City Council meeting November 4, 2020, at 5:30 p.m.
